Course Content

• Water Audit Techniques and Accounting for Water Costs
• Sustainability Reporting Frameworks (GRI, SASB, TCFD) and Water Disclosure
• Water Risk Assessment and Management for Financial Reporting
• Integrated Water Resource Management (IWRM) and its Financial Implications
• Water Conservation Strategies and Cost-Benefit Analysis for Businesses
• Environmental, Social, and Governance (ESG) Investing and Water Security
• Data Analysis and Visualization for Water Performance Reporting
• Case Studies: Successful Water Conservation Initiatives and their Financial Impact
• Advanced Water Accounting and Reporting Standards (national and international)
• Developing a Water Conservation Strategy for an Organization (including financial projections)

Career Role (Water Conservation & Accounting) Description
Sustainability Accountant Analyze environmental performance, including water usage, and integrate it into financial reporting. High demand in the UK's growing green sector.
Water Resources Analyst (Accounting Focus) Assess water-related risks and opportunities for organizations, producing financial models for water conservation initiatives. Crucial for water-intensive industries.
Environmental Management Accountant Manage and report on environmental costs, including water management expenses. A key role in driving sustainable business practices.
Corporate Social Responsibility (CSR) Accountant Integrate environmental sustainability goals into financial reporting and demonstrate the business value of water conservation strategies.
